File access modes used by Ganga Jobs
Currently if users are submitting Ganga jobs with the LCG backend, the posix I/O access is the default method to access files (j.inputdata.type='DQ2_LOCAL')
One of the alternative access mode used by ST tests is the FileStager mode, which copies the input files in a background thread of the athena event loop usinglcg-cp from the local SE to the worker node tmp area. (j.inputdata.type='FILE_STAGER') This mode still needs a bit of improvements to gain full stability, but as demonstrated good performance at some (but not all) sites. Two access modes may be used during ST tests.
